Significance: Models the śiṣya-bhāva: humility and earnest inquiry are prerequisites for receiving teaching and grace (anugraha).
It highlights śravaṇa (reverent listening) and saṃśaya-nivṛtti (removal of doubt) as essential steps for steady devotion to Śiva and for right knowledge that supports liberation.
Before practicing Saguna worship—such as Liṅga-pūjā—devotees seek clear understanding from an authoritative narrator/teacher, so worship is grounded in correct doctrine and faith rather than confusion.
The implied practice is kathā-śravaṇa (listening to Śiva Purāṇa) with humility and inquiry; this supports mantra-japa (especially Pañcākṣarī, “Om Namaḥ Śivāya”) by making the mind doubt-free and focused.
